How much importance does a Search Engine gives to the actual matter or data on the home page? Is that more than the back-links?
By "Actual matter or data" I think you mean "content", No doubt content has greatest importance because this is one of the factor by which search engines rank your website according to the quality of your content also if you produce unique content, it will help you to get backlinks naturally and you'll find many websites start linking back to your website that means content has more importance than backlinks, it make easier to get backlinks.. Also the homepage has greater significance, it's important page for both human visitors and search engines, the content at homepage needs to be extremely relevant to your site's theme.
Does the sub-domain pages have less importance in Search Engines?
Nope, Google consider sub domain as regular domain so it would have similar importance like main domain name. While using subdomain it would be best if you add vertical content to your subdomain page that can support it as a standalone page. For example Google is using subdomain like maps.google.com, news.google.com, code.google.com etc and all are standalone and have individual importance.Last edited by paul; 12-12-2009 at 08:32.

Very well explained Paul

@Bryan : The subdomains are considered as individual pages and hence you will find that there is a difference in the number of backlinks to each subdomain of the same domain and due to this reason, you will also find that page rank of the subdomains and the home page of the website may and sometimes do vary."A Penny Saved is a Penny Earned"
